Having nothing pressing to do and wanting to get out for a few hours, I tracked down a small park in Beacon NY that I had read about -- Madam Brett Park -- along the banks of the Fishkill Creek. It is a small park, more linear than anything else. In one direction the white trail leads to a waterfall on the creek, pictured here. In the other direction is an abandoned hat factory and a white trail passes over a boardwalk and connects to Dennings Point Park along the Hudson River. The second photo is from an offshoot of the white trail (the red trail) where the creek meets the Hudson River.
